This post compares Agoura Hills, California to Merced,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Agoura Hills (city) Merced (city)
Population 20,736 82,008
Income (median) $80,143 $38,635
Home Value (median) $745,000 $185,700
White 82% 53%
Black 2% 5%
Asian 8% 12%
With Kids 36% 43%
Age (median) 44 29
Rentals 25% 60%

Questions and Answers:

Q: Which is more populated, Agoura Hills or Merced?
A: Agoura Hills has a much smaller population count than Merced: 20736 compared with 82008 total people.

Q: Do incomes tend to be higher in Agoura Hills or in Merced?
A: Incomes are on average much higher in Agoura Hills.

Q: Are homes more expensive in Agoura Hills or Merced?
A: Homes tend to be much more expensive in Agoura Hills.

Q: Which has a higher percentage of housing rental units?
A: Merced does. The percentage of rentals differs quite a bit: 25% for Agoura Hills versus 60% for Merced.
